Xbox’s Disc-To-Digital Program Has A Big Problem: Several Major Publishers Aren’t Participating

Xbox's disc-to-digital program looks like it could be a vital step forward for players who want to hold on to their physical games in an increasingly digital world, but it does have limits. Not every game publisher is on board with it, it seems, as Xbox users are reporting that four of the biggest companies aren't "participating" at all. So far, it looks like games from Sega, Square Enix, Ubisoft, and Bandai Namco are largely incompatible with the disc-to-digital service. As verified by Kotak...
